Cantaloupe Bread

1-2 hrs
ingredients
3 eggs, beaten
1 cup vegetable oil
2 cups sugar
3 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 cantaloupe, cut into 2" chunks and pureed
3 cups flour
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on baking soda
3/4 teaspoon baking powder
2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ground ginger
1 cup chopped walnuts
directions
Mix eggs, oil, sugar and vanilla. Add pureed cantaloupe to mixture. Sift dry ingredients. Add to liquid.
Pour into two greased and floured 9" x 5" loaf pan. Bake at 325 degrees F for 1 hour or until done.
